diff --git a/README.md b/README.md index 26f4493..3bbd8f3 100644 --- a/README.md +++ b/README.md @@ -2,7 +2,7 @@ ## Descripción: CitaSalud, es un sistema de gestión de citas y diagnóstico. El proyecto se realiza en base a una tarea para el curso de Sistemas de Información I. -Consiste de un Sistema Web, con un servidor escrito en Python y su framework Django, y dos interfaces: Una web, y otra de escritorio. +Consiste de un Sistema de Información Web para optimizacion de tiempos y costos en la administración de citas y diagnóstico de un hospital. > **Enunciado**: [Práctica 02](./docs/README.md) > @@ -13,8 +13,43 @@ Consiste de un Sistema Web, con un servidor escrito en Python y su framework Dja > - Vasquez Muñoz, Brenda > - Polo Zavala, Nick +## Arquitectura del SI +El sistema consta de un servidor escrito en Python y su framework Django, y dos interfaces: Una interfaz web usada por los Pacientes, Doctores, Administradores, y una interfaz de escritorio que es usada por únicamente por Personal del Hospital (Administradores, Supervisores, Gerencia, Doctores, etc). + +### Backend +- **Aplicación Web:** Django(Python) + - **API REST:** Django REST Framework +- **Motor de Base de Datos:** SQLite / MySQL / PostgreSQL +- **Servidor de Aplicaciones:** Nginx / Apache + +### Frontend +- **Interfaz Web Escritorio/Móvil**: HTML5 + CSS3 + - **Diseño:** Material Design + - **Programación:** jQuery (Javascript) + +- **Interfaz de Escritorio:** Electron (Packaged Webkit Browser + io.js) + - **Diseño:** Material Design (Angular Material Design) + - **Programación:** AngularJS+io.js (Javascript) + ## Implementación +### Entorno de desarrollo + +Se deben instalar los siguientes requerimientos: +``` + Django==1.8 + django-extensions==1.5.5 + django-localflavor==1.1 + djangorestframework==3.1.1 + Markdown==2.6.2 + MySQL-python==1.2.5 + Pillow==2.8.1 + pygraphviz==1.2 + six==1.9.0 +``` +### Producción +[...] ## Capturas +![](https://raw.github.com/rcotrina94/citasalud/master/docs/images/001.png) diff --git a/docs/images/001.png b/docs/images/001.png new file mode 100644 index 0000000..d35387c Binary files /dev/null and b/docs/images/001.png differ diff --git a/docs/images/002.png b/docs/images/002.png new file mode 100644 index 0000000..53943a9 Binary files /dev/null and b/docs/images/002.png differ diff --git a/docs/images/003.png b/docs/images/003.png new file mode 100644 index 0000000..c574680 Binary files /dev/null and b/docs/images/003.png differ